Corrosion resistant performance of hydrophobic poly(N-vinyl imidazole-co-ethyl methacrylate) coating on mild steel

Anti-corrosive azole and methacrylate based copolymer has been successfully synthesized.

Synthesized copolymers act as successful coating against corrosion of mild steel.

Imidazole with methacrylate based copolymers coatings exhibit mixed type of corrosion protection.

Water contact angle measurement indicates the hydrophobic nature of the copolymer film on mild steel surface.

Surface characterizations like SEM-EDX, AFM and FTIR also confirm corrosion protecting behaviour of the copolymer.
